Apply for this job → About the Role
Food Service Workers perform tasks with several steps or a sequence of tasks that requires attention to work operations. They can work in one or more functional areas of the kitchen such as food preparation dish and pot washing,dry and refrigerate storage and receiving, and the serving area doing work such as portioning cold food, dipping hot food, working in the dish room and passing trays.
What You'll Do
- →Shift will be 6:00 am - 10:00 am, 10:00 am - 12:00 pm or 4:00 pm - 8:00 pm depending upon the needs of the service.
- →Position Description Title/PD#: Food Service Worker/PD99920S Physical Requirements and Work Conditions: Work is performed in kitchen areas where the steam and heat from cooking and dishwashing equipment often cause uncomfortably high temperatures and humidity.
- →Performs work requiring light to moderate physical.
- →May be required to perform heavy work, such as scouring and scrubbing large size cooking utensils and pushing heavy carts and trucks in unloading, storing, and delivering supplies.
- →Subject to continuous standing and walking, and frequent stooping, reaching, pushing, pulling, and bending.
- →Frequently lifts or moves objects weighing up to 20 pounds unassisted and occasionally lift or move objects weighing more than 40 pounds with the assistance of others.
